Confused I have a Melobar Rattler 8 str lap that i want to update the pu .I checked with Georgel's and their model 10-1 would be great except they are too high for this guitar.I don't know what brand is on the guitar now,it is original,but does'nt perform very vell compared to my Magnatone.I think this pu is actually for a 6 str as the two outer strings do not have much sound or tone compared to the rest.Any help would be appreciated..

It's just fine - because the pickups were designed for a 6-string 'regular' guitar. I'm not sure how they'd work with 8 strings, heading off toward the edges like that - I suspect that exactly what you're experiencing would happen.

Very Happy SENT THE BEZEL FROM MY PU TO VINTAGEVIBE GUITARS AND HAD THEM DO A REWIND FOR THIS GUITAR.GOOD PRICE AND FAST.MUCH MUCH BETTER PERFORMANCE AND SOUND.ALSO MADE A NEW BRIDGE FROM SOLID BRASS W/ INCREASED STRING SPACING,BETTER SUSTAIN.ORIGINAL BRIDGE WAS PLASTIC AND STRING GROOVES WERE VERY BAD.REBILT THE NUT AS WELL AS IT WAS NOT STE UP PROPERLY.WHEN I AM ALL DONE I WILL POST NEW PICS W/UPDATE
